C ++ fabs () - standardní knihovna C ++

Funkce fabs () v C ++ vrací absolutní hodnotu argumentu.

Je definován v hlavičkovém souboru.

(Matematika) | x | = fabs (x) (programování v C ++)

prototyp fabs () (podle standardu C ++ 11)

dvojité báječky (dvojité x); float fabs (float x); dlouhé dvojité faby (dlouhé dvojité x); dvojité blány (T x); // Pro integrální typ

Funkce funkčních bloků vzdušného prostoru () má jediný parametr a vrací hodnotu typu double, floatnebo long doubletypu.

fabs () parametry

Funkce fabs () přebírá jediný argument x, jehož absolutní hodnota je vrácena.

fabs () Návratová hodnota

Funkce fabs () vrací absolutní hodnotu x, tj. | X |.

Příklad 1: Jak funguje funkce fabs () v C ++?

 #include #include using namespace std; int main() ( double x = -10.25, result; result = fabs(x); cout << "fabs(" << x << ") = |" << x << "| = " << result << endl; return 0; ) 

Když spustíte program, výstup bude:

fabs (-10,25) = | -10,25 | = 10,25

Příklad 2: Funkce fabs () pro integrální typy

 #include #include using namespace std; int main() ( long int x = -23; double result; result = fabs(x); cout << "fabs(" << x << ") = |" << x << "| = " << result << endl; return 0; ) 

Když spustíte program, výstup bude:

fabs (-23) = | -23 | = 23

Zajímavé články...